First u have to make 38.75 Mhz video carrier modulator with TDA 5660/4. Then use the saw filter from siemens of the above specs. Then use mixer circuit with oscillator for upgrading the modulator from 38.75 to ur required frequency. Further just amplify and use simple narrow band filters for the required bandwidth. But for all this u need spectrum anlyser or sweep generator to tune the filters. Hope this will help u to understand. This way the commercial modulators r made.

I don't think you are going to find VSB SAW filters to be used at VHF or UHF frequencies.
The VSB SAW filters for TV are manufactured only for IF frequency that are standard for each channel format.
The normal procedure to design a TV Modulator is first to modulate an IF signal with the video to be transmitted, then the IF is filtered using a SAW filter to conform the vestigial side band and last the modulated IF should be converted to the desired channel.
Anyway if you want to design a VSB filter at UHF or VHF frequencies you will have to do it by yourself using discrete LC components. But be aware that is a difficult design.
